ASCE/SEI 24-05

Flood Resistant Design and Construction

This Standard, Flood Resistant Design and Construction (ASCE/SEI 24-05), provides minimum requirements for flood-resistant design and construction of structures located in flood hazard areas. This Standard applies to new construction which includes: (a) new structures including subsequent work to such structures, and (b)work classified as substantial repair or substantial improvement of an existing structure that is not an historic structure. This Standard is a revision of ASCE/SEI 24-98. Topics include: Basic requirements for flood hazard areas; High risk flood hazard areas; Coastal high hazard areas and Coastal A Zones; Materials; Dry and Wet Floodproofing; Utilities; Building Access; Miscellaneous construction.
